Introduction
The gambling landscape in Norway is characterized by a strict monopoly, primarily controlled by the government through Norsk Tipping and Norsk Rikstoto. Despite this, offshore casinos have increasingly targeted Norwegian players, creating a complex dynamic that regular gamblers must navigate. Main Features and Details
Offshore casinos typically operate under licenses from jurisdictions known for their lenient gambling regulations, such as Malta, Gibraltar, or Curacao. This allows them to offer services to players in Norway without adhering to the same restrictions that local operators face. Key features of these casinos include:
- Game Variety: Offshore casinos provide a broader selection of games, including exclusive titles and innovative gaming experiences that are often not available in Norway.
- Bonuses and Promotions: Many offshore platforms offer attractive welcome bonuses, free spins, and loyalty programs that can significantly enhance the gambling experience.
- Payment Options: Offshore casinos often support a wide range of payment methods, including cryptocurrencies, which appeal to tech-savvy players seeking anonymity and security.
- Accessibility: Players can access these casinos from anywhere with an internet connection, providing convenience and flexibility that local options may lack.

Advantages and Disadvantages
While offshore casinos present numerous advantages, they also come with certain risks and disadvantages that players should consider:
- Advantages:
- Wider selection of games and betting options.
- More lucrative bonuses and promotions.
- Greater accessibility and convenience.
- Disadvantages:
- Potential legal issues, as Norwegian law prohibits gambling on unlicensed sites.
- Risk of fraud or untrustworthy operators, as not all offshore casinos are reputable.
- Lack of consumer protection and recourse in case of disputes.
